Abstract
A mirror mounting apparatus which includes three tangent bars through which a mirror is mounted to a housing. One end of each of the tangent bars is mounted to the housing through a first spherical bearing while the second end of the tangent bar is mounted to the mirror through a second spherical bearing. The first spherical bearing has an axis perpendicular to the plane of the mirror. The second spherical bearing is oriented to have an axis perpendicular to both the axis of the first spherical bearing and to a line tangent to the point of attachment on the outer circumference of the mirror of the tangent bar.
